Output 6c0312f5878de2d8c81db4e5472f1f19f91b040780fc4dbf0e3d168332c9f502:0

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d921884c579ea7e27e46021fadf85d2c6a8ed7 OP_EQUAL
address
31mW34xrk7T8yaxGq7BS4pJPt2VxKvbqU8
transaction
6c0312f5878de2d8c81db4e5472f1f19f91b040780fc4dbf0e3d168332c9f502
spent
true